– For most users, the recommended choice is "Adjust the OS to the new hardware automatically" . This lets the tool handle driver injection and kernel changes without manual intervention. The manual option ("Load additional drivers if needed") is only necessary if Windows does not contain built‑in drivers for your new hardware.
